Output 6870e91294069dce6e15ae2f6b05ab70d42fc8e2ed5c0c0c889b62cdc496907a:10

value
1620108
script pubkey
OP_0 OP_PUSHBYTES_20 35a27237a73ba607f554da576e150069795ec14b
address
bc1qxk38yda88wnq0a25mftku9gqd9u4as2twt2ay8
transaction
6870e91294069dce6e15ae2f6b05ab70d42fc8e2ed5c0c0c889b62cdc496907a
spent
false